在数字化时代,编程已经成为一项必备技能。而Keys编程,作为一种简单易学的编程语言,尤其适合初学者入门。本文将为你介绍一些实用的技巧,帮助你轻松掌握Keys编程,开启你的编程新世界。
Keys编程简介
Keys编程是一种基于图形化界面的编程语言,它通过拖拽代码块的方式来实现程序功能。这种编程方式降低了编程的门槛,使得即使是编程小白也能快速上手。
入门实用技巧
1. 熟悉界面
在开始编程之前,首先要熟悉Keys编程的界面。界面主要由以下几个部分组成:
- 工具箱:提供各种代码块,用于实现不同的功能。
- 代码区:放置你编写的代码块。
- 运行按钮:点击后,程序开始执行。
- 控制台:显示程序运行过程中的信息。
2. 选择合适的代码块
Keys编程提供了丰富的代码块,包括控制流程、数据操作、图形显示等。在编写程序时,要根据需求选择合适的代码块。以下是一些常用的代码块:
- 控制流程:条件判断、循环等。
- 数据操作:数学运算、字符串处理等。
- 图形显示:绘制图形、动画等。
3. 编写代码
在代码区,你可以通过拖拽代码块来编写程序。需要注意的是,代码块的顺序和连接方式会影响程序的执行结果。以下是一个简单的例子:
开始
> 如果 (变量a > 10)
> 输出 (变量a)
结束
这段代码的意思是:如果变量a的值大于10,就输出变量a的值。
4. 调试程序
在编程过程中,难免会遇到错误。这时,可以通过以下方法来调试程序:
- 查看控制台信息:了解程序运行过程中的异常情况。
- 单步执行:逐个执行代码块,观察程序执行过程。
- 断点调试:在关键位置设置断点,观察变量值的变化。
5. 优化代码
编写程序时,要注意代码的可读性和可维护性。以下是一些优化代码的建议:
- 使用有意义的变量名和函数名。
- 将代码分解成模块,提高代码复用性。
- 使用注释说明代码功能。
Keys编程实例
以下是一个使用Keys编程实现的简单游戏实例:
开始
> 创建变量 (分数)
> 创建变量 (生命值)
> 创建变量 (游戏结束)
> 设置 (分数) 为 0
> 设置 (生命值) 为 3
> 设置 (游戏结束) 为 假
> 循环 (当 (游戏结束) 为 假)
> > 创建变量 (随机X)
> > 创建变量 (随机Y)
> > 随机 (随机X) 在 0 到 100
> > 随机 (随机Y) 在 0 到 100
> > 创建变量 (玩家X)
> > 创建变量 (玩家Y)
> > 设置 (玩家X) 为 50
> > 设置 (玩家Y) 为 50
> > 创建变量 (球X)
> > 创建变量 (球Y)
> > 设置 (球X) 为 (随机X)
> > 设置 (球Y) 为 (随机Y)
> > 创建变量 (球速度X)
> > 创建变量 (球速度Y)
> > 设置 (球速度X) 为 1
> > 设置 (球速度Y) 为 1
> > 创建变量 (碰撞)
> > 碰撞检测 (球X, 球Y, 球速度X, 球速度Y, 玩家X, 玩家Y)
> > 如果 (碰撞)
> > > 设置 (生命值) 为 (生命值) - 1
> > > 如果 (生命值) 小于等于 0
> > > > 设置 (游戏结束) 为 真
> > > > 输出 (游戏结束)
> > > > 结束
> > > > 输出 (生命值)
> > > 结束
> > 结束
> > 更新屏幕
结束
这个游戏实例通过控制球的位置和速度,以及检测球与玩家的碰撞来实现游戏逻辑。
总结
掌握Keys编程需要时间和实践。通过本文介绍的一些实用技巧,相信你已经对Keys编程有了初步的了解。只要不断练习,你一定能够解锁编程新世界,成为编程高手!
